在日常办公或学习中,我们经常需要处理许多Word文档,尤其是在组织文件或进行数据翻译时,确保文档名称的统一与准确显得尤为重要。正因如此,批量复制Word名称成为了一个热门话题。本文将为您详细介绍一些实用的方法,帮助您有效地批量复制Word文档名称。
一、批量复制Word名称的基本方法
1. 使用资源管理器直接重命名
在Windows操作系统中,您可以通过资源管理器直接进行文档名称的重命名,以下是具体步骤:
- 打开包含Word文档的文件夹。
- 选择您想要复制名称的文档。
- 右键点击选中的文档,选择“重命名”。
- 使用复制(Ctrl+C)和粘贴(Ctrl+V)功能来操作。
这种方法简单有效,适用于少量文档的名称复制。
2. 利用Word VBA宏进行批量操作
对于需要批量处理大量文档的用户,VBA宏是一个更加高效的工具。
-
首先,按下
Alt + F11
打开VBA编辑器。 -
创建一个新的模块,并输入以下代码:
vb Sub CopyDocumentNames() Dim doc As Document Dim fileName As String Dim docList As StringFor Each doc In Application.Documents fileName = doc.Name docList = docList & fileName & vbCrLf Next doc '将结果输出到新的文档 Documents.Add Selection.TypeText docList
End Sub
-
运行宏后,所有打开的Word文档名称将会被复制到新的文档中。
二、使用第三方工具
除了使用Word和VBA,您还可以寻找一些第三方工具,比如文件管理软件,这些软件通常会提供批量处理的功能。
以下是一些推荐的工具:
- Total Commander:功能强大,允许用户批量重命名文件。
- Bulk Rename Utility:专门用于批量重命名文件,可以批量复制名称。
三、直接在Word中复制
对于少量文档,您也可以直接在Word中复制名称。操作步骤如下:
- 打开Word文档并查看标题。
- 直接用鼠标选中标题,然后右键点击选择“复制”。
- 使用粘贴功能将名称粘贴到需要的位置。
四、批量复制Word名称的常见问题
1. 如何批量复制Word文档名称到Excel?
在Word中直接整合文档名称到Excel是非常方便的。通过前述的宏,你可以将文档名称输出到新文档,再将其复制到Excel。你也可以在Excel中使用“外部数据”-“从文本”,导入文件夹中的文档名称。
2. 提取Word文档名称的格式如何统一?
为了确保格式统一,建议使用命名规则,比如标题+日期,进行相关命名。此外,您还可以在Excel中使用FORMULA(如CONCATENATE
)来批量生成想要的文档名称格式。
3. 有哪些常见的批量文件处理工具?
一些常见的批量文件处理工具包括:
- Windows PowerShell:可以通过编写脚本进行批量处理。
- Renamer:支持多种文件格式的批量重命名。
4. 批量复制后如何管理这些文档?
一旦您成功复制文档名称,可以考虑创建一个Excel表格或Word文档来管理这些文件。可以在表格每列中添加文件路径、状态、重要性等级等信息,从而方便后期的查找与管理。
总结
批量复制Word名称的方法有很多,无论是通过资源管理器、VBA宏,还是第三方工具,都能有效提高工作效率。希望本文提供的技巧能够帮助到您,提升您在办公软件中的使用技能。如果您对Word使用技巧有任何其他问题,欢迎随时咨询!